Scope
This test method covers the determination of the flexural creep stiffness or compliance of asphalt mixtures by means of a bending beam rheometer. It is applicable to material having a flexural stiffness value from 2 GPa to 20 GPa (creep compliance values in the range of 0.5 nPa?C1 to 0.05 nPa?C1). The test apparatus is designed for testing within the temperature range from 36 to 0?? Test results are valid for beams of asphalt mixtures that deflect at least 15 ?? and less than 150 ?? (550 microstrains) during the entire duration of the test@ when tested in accordance with this method. This method has been verified with asphalt mixtures having a nominal maximum aggregate size of 12.5 mm. This standard may involve hazardous materials@ operations@ and equipment.
